We have an opportunity for a Commercial Gas Engineer to join our Commercial Gas Management team, based in Sheffield, covering surrounding areas. You will be required to safely, efficiently, and professionally deliver installation, servicing, maintenance, and repair of commercial gas systems and associated mechanical equipment. The role ensures compliance with industry regulations, supports operational reliability for customers, and contributes to safe and effective gas network or plant operations.

The role of Commercial Gas Engineer will include:

  • Carry out installation, fault fixing, maintenance duties, installation and commissioning of gas central heating systems within commercial properties
  • Provide accurate and timely information on progress and advice that is easily understood by the customer and ensure accurate daily work records are completed
  • Respond positively to complaints and breakdowns in service delivery to meet customer expectations
  • Resolve problems or set into motion the means of resolution, ensuring customers are kept informed
  • Ensure tools and equipment are maintained in good condition and stocks are replenished as needed

 

Skills and experiences:

  • To ensure full compliance with health and safety legislation, candidates applying for this role must be qualified to CCN1,CENWAT,CKR1,HTR1, COCN1 / CODNCO1, ICPN1, TPCP1/1A, CIGA1, CORT1, CDGA1CCN1, CENWAT,CKR1, CPA1, Gas Auditing Qualification, HTR1, Unvented - G3 Certificate, Water Regulations (WRAS)- Or currently undertaking the qualifications. As part of the interview process, candidates will be required to bring with them the original certification verifying proof of their qualifications. Copies and CSCS cards will not be accepted.
  • Recent experience of undertaking a similar role
  • Working knowledge of the application of Health and Safety legislation
  • Proven experience of working to deadlines and prioritising work loads
  • Excellent communication and customer care skills
  • Working knowledge of the installation, servicing and maintenance of gas heating systems in commercial properties
  • This role will involve driving on company business. In order to drive a company vehicle, drivers must hold a full valid UK driving licence
